On July 13, 2017 Ciara Newton, a former Refinery Process Operator, filed a suit against Equilon Enterprises LLC, the corporate name for Shell Oil Products. Her suit alleges she was discriminated against on the basis of her sex, harassed because of her sex and retaliated against because she complained of sexual harassment and gender discrimination. She brings her complaint pursuant to California\u2019s Fair Employment and Housing Act, which is analogous to Title VII of the Civil Rights Code of 1964.<br \/>\nAccording to her complaint, Newton was constantly subjected to a <a href=\"https:\/\/discriminationandsexualharassmentlawyers.com\/employment-law\/sexual-harassment\/hostile-work-environment\/\">hostile work environment<\/a>, a sort of boys club where women were constantly subjected to derogatory remarks, making it hard for her to perform her job duties. Newton says she was constantly taunted with comments like, \u201cif you\u2019re pussy hurts, just stay home\u201d and \u201cwomen don\u2019t last long [in this department].\u201d Newton\u2019s supervisors, not only tolerated, but also encouraged this type of behavior. Newton was often belittled by being told she was not \u201cmechanically inclined,\u201d which was a completely untrue shot at her abilities as a mechanic. She routinely complained to human resources, but Shell failed to take any corrective action. Further, Newton was a model employee, even reporting dangerous conditions, such as a sulfuric acid spill which poised huge health risks to employees. Even Newton\u2019s complaints of dangerous working conditions went unresolved as Newton\u2019s supervisor told her not to report the dangerous conditions because he could get in trouble.<br \/>\nWhile Newton brought her claims under California State Laws, Federal discrimination laws such as Title VII of the Civil Rights Act of 1964, were designed to prohibit this type of sexual harassment and gender discrimination in the workplace. Under Title VII, it is unlawful for an employer to discriminate against an individual based on their sex. Sexual joking and derogatory remarks regarding an individual\u2019s sex create a prima facie case of discrimination, warranting a charge with the Equal Employment Opportunity Commission (\u201cEEOC\u201d), the Federal agency tasked with handling employment discrimination claims.<br \/>\nAlong with protections for individuals who have been discriminated against, Title VII also provides protections for individuals who pursue claims of sexual harassment.
